About the job Product Marketing Manager
Functional Summary

Manages, develops, and implements marketing activities to maximize sales of an assigned product line. Analyzes product performance, competitiveness, and trends in the marketplace and develops strategies for assigned product based on research and analysis. Works with sales teams to identify and implement appropriate sales strategies.

Duties and Responsibilities
•Develops comprehensive marketing plans for sales and marketing teams
•Ensures project/department goals are met while adhering to approved budgets
•Conduct and analyze market research to capitalize on new product and market development opportunities
•Collect, consolidate, and communicate product feedback and product development needs to management
•Interact with sales and marketing teams to implement strategies and tactics to drive revenue and profit growth
•Track and monitor sales trend and provide product forecast
•Create, execute, and measure effectiveness of Go-To-Market Plans for strategic launches
•Identify customers who are willing to give testimonials, case studies and references and amplify their voice in the market
•Measure and refine product marketing programs to ensure alignment with corporate goals
•Develop relevant content to be used for all Go-To-Market channels and materials
•Design training programs to assist sales focus on each step of the selling process
•Provide marketing and solution information to regional marketing and sales teams to support internal and external marketing programs, sales operations, marketing events such as conferences, trade shows and webinars, and channel opportunities and activities
•Increase visibility on social media platforms, including Facebook, Twitter, Google+ for the corporate channels
•Stay current with industry practice on marketing communications impacting communications tactics
•Acts as a Product Line brand champion and ensure that use of the brand is compliant
•Support organizational policies related to safety, environmental protection, housekeeping, etc. within area of responsibility
